COMPLETE AND UNABRIDGED. With a new Introduction by Cedric Watts, ResearchProfessor of English, University of Sussex. James Joyces astonishingmasterpiece, Ulysses, tells of the diverse events which befall LeopoldBloom and Stephen Dedalus in Dublin on 16 June 1904, during which Bloomsvoluptuous wife, Molly, commits adultery. Initially deemed obscene inEngland and the USA, this richly-allusive novel, revolutionary in itsModernistic experimentalism, was hailed as a work of genius by W. B.Yeats, T. S. Eliot and Ernest Hemingway. Scandalously frank, wittilyerudite, mercurially eloquent, resourcefully comic and generously humane,Ulysses offers the reader a life-changing experience.
